resident or best ountry Junior Gregory Cooper, All- Star 4-H club president, was the overall leader through the San Joaquin County. At the age of eight, Cooper became interested in the 4-H club when the majority of kids in his neighborhood were joining the club. Another reason accord- ing to Cooper was, My father used to be an electric leader in the 4-H club. Cooper decided to run for All-Stars president because he wanted to make a better leader out of himself and make his club the best in the country . Within the San Joaquin county alone, there were 45 members who represented the club at state ' .. and regional functions. Cooper's responsibilities were to represent the All-Stars at functions, hand out awards, and to run the All-Stars meetings, which were once a month. The All-Stars group planned many activities during the year such as an exchange trip to Wisconsin, a Dodge Ridge ski trip, and 4-H camp at Silver Lake during the summer. Some other interests in the 4-H All-Stars club were various outdoor activities such as tradi- tional 4-H science projects, Aerospace and Aviation, and fly fishing to name a few. To keep with tradition, the club held several holiday parties, fund raisers, and a canned food drive. Also, the club competed with other clubs at county fairs. 236 With hopes of being nominat- ed as Stockton's Miss Chinatown and much encouragement from her parents, junior Caryle Young had danced in Stockton's Chi- nese Folk Dance Troupe since the age of 12. To be a sufficient nominee, a person must be ages 17 or 18, active in the Chinese community and be nominated by other Chinese organizations. Under the instruction of Bon- nie Lew and direction of Shirley Ng, Young practiced her danc- ing at least once a week for three hours. My parents wanted me to dance to become more active in the Chinese community, said Young. Young and Stockton's Chi- nese Folk Dance Troupe have performed at many places, some which include the Chinese New Year's Festival at the Stockton Civic Auditorium, the State Fair O Young d toward Chinese for the Year of the Tiger, Micke's Grove International Festival, Sac- ramento Buddist Church Ba- zaar, and for convalescent homes. Young enjoyed dancing with the troupe and performing for the community, I plan to stay in the dance troupe until l graduate and go away to college, said Young.
